Local Fitment for Varying Block Types

Fencing layout needs to match how your site is used. Before we install, we assess driveways, boundaries, shed access, and paddock layout to ensure the fence supports both movement and protection.

On larger sites, this includes mapping gate points for vehicles or livestock, marking tree lines or drainage that may affect panel runs, and selecting post types based on surface hardness or sloped ground. For smaller blocks or areas with equipment storage, spacing is adjusted to keep access clear without limiting use.

We avoid placing fence lines where they may block sheds, narrow machinery paths, or cut off useful zones. Each post and panel is aligned to keep the layout efficient and easy to maintain.

The result is a fence that fits the site, not one that creates extra work later.

Install Options

We install mesh types that suit paddock fencing, entry control, or property sectioning.

Chainlink Mesh

Standard wire mesh fencing for marking property lines, guiding livestock movement, and setting clear access zones.

Welded Mesh

A solid barrier option for high-contact areas like animal pens, work yards, or internal separation between zones.

Security Mesh

For entry points near sheds, machinery bays, or storage access. Helps deter unwanted entry and controls foot traffic.

Temporary Fencing

Quick deployment fencing used on projects needing fast control during install phases or events.

Access Gates

We supply gates that suit walk-through, drive-in, or side-entry use—hinged or sliding based on access type.

Slope-Adjusted Fitment

Fence lines fitted around paddocks or uneven terrain, with angled bracing and staggered post support.
